How to export from Hevy
- Open the Hevy app on your phone
- Go to Settings (gear icon)
- Scroll down and tap "Export Data"
- Choose "Export as CSV"
- Save or share the file to your device
- Upload the CSV file here

Frequently Asked Questions
What happens to exercises not in my library?
New exercises are created automatically during import. You can rename or merge them later in your exercise library.
Will this create duplicates?
We check for existing workouts by date and name. If a workout with the same date and name already exists, it will be skipped.
Can I undo an import?
Currently, imported workouts cannot be bulk-undone. We recommend reviewing the preview carefully before importing.
What about kg vs lbs?
Use the unit toggle in the preview to specify whether your file uses pounds or kilograms. Weights are stored in your preferred unit.
How long does the import take?
Most imports complete in under 30 seconds. Very large files (5000+ workouts) may take a minute or two.
